Hi all!

In the near future we're going to be putting together a small production in Vancouver, and are looking to gain insight and possibly collaborate from those who live or work there. After our last experience shooting in BC, I've been dying to get back there and do more work!

Right now we're working in Los Angeles, so we're a little tied down at the moment, but we're casting a few lines to see who is out there.

Right now our big questions are:

1. Is shooting in downtown affordable on a 'lower' budget? (plazas, public parks, etc) Or does anyone have experiences they could share about shooting there?

2. Any downtown locations you would recommend?

3. How would you compare it to shooting in the US, if you've shot here as well?

We shoot guerilla when we need to, but proper channels are definitely needed for this particular production (fake weapons, etc). If you guys have any footage you have that you could share, I would be very interested in checking it out. Obviously, we'll be shooting on RED... enough said!

Any advice or comments on this would be greatly appreciated!

I live about a ten minute walk from downtown. I moved here from Vancouver Island about a week ago ( have a couple of art galleries representing my fine art photography out here). I just literally got home from a many hours long walk/scout of the downtown area; cracked a beer and saw your post. Well, unless you're shooting Little House on the Prairie, it's an awesome city with a great contrast of lifestyles living more or less shoulder to shoulder. From the down and outs on East Hastings and its many alleys, to the nearby shining towers of wealth overlooking mountains and ocean. And from what I hear ( I have a few connections in the film community) it's a very film user friendly place.

Like Jeremy says: it would help to know what you're looking for, genre, etc..
